- Warner Bros. Pictures Animation said a new Powerpuff Girls feature is in development during its presentation at the Annecy International Animation Film Festival on Monday, June 22, 2026.
- Studio sources stressed the project has not been greenlit and no deal, plot, cast, creative team or release date has been finalized.
- Coverage and studio statements do not clarify whether the film connects to the 2022 revival that named original creator Craig McCracken or to other prior revival efforts.
- The franchise has a mixed modern record that shapes expectations: the 2002 theatrical film underperformed at the box office, a 2016 reboot drew poor reviews from many fans, and a planned live-action series was cancelled before airing.
- The announcement adds the property to Warner Bros. Pictures Animation's growing theatrical slate and gives fans and industry watchers a clear signal to watch for formal greenlight, casting, and creative updates next.
